Bubba Gump Shrimp Co. Menu With Prices

Bubba Gump Shrimp Co. built its entire identity around the classic film “Forrest Gump,” naming dishes and decor after characters like Lt. Dan and Jenny while serving a genuinely wide seafood menu spanning shrimp prepared a dozen different ways, pasta, burgers, salads, and Southern-style sides. Most menu items fall under $20, with entrées generally ranging from $15 to $30 depending on the specific seafood or protein chosen.

Premium items, including seafood platters and combination meals designed for multiple guests, sit at the higher end of the range, typically priced between $40 and $70. The restaurant also offers gluten-free options across both the regular and kids’ menus, including Shrimp Scampi, Steamed Crab Legs, and the classic Shrimp Cocktail.

Signature Shrimp Dishes

Signature shrimp dishes are the heart of the Bubba Gump menu, and “Of Course We Have Scampi” is one of the most requested items, combining linguine tossed in lobster butter sauce with tomato-soaked juicy shrimp for a rich, buttery, salty flavor combination. Garlic bread is served alongside as the classic pairing for this dish.

Shrimper’s Heaven showcases shrimp prepared three different ways on one plate — fried, coconut, and tempura — giving guests a chance to sample multiple preparations without ordering separate dishes. The breaded and battered shrimp across all three styles delivers a satisfying crunch alongside the more delicate coconut version.

Peel ‘n’ Eat Shrimp, steamed in either a beer garlic or Cajun preparation, is available by the half-pound at $18.99 or the full pound at $29.99, making it a popular choice for guests who want a hands-on, classic shrimp boil experience rather than a plated entrée.

Crab & Shrimp Boils

Crab and Shrimp Boils bring together red potatoes, sausages, shrimp, snow crab, and corn in one hearty, Southern-inspired dish, and guests can choose between a Cajun or garlic broth to set the overall flavor direction — smoky and spicy-umami versus a more classic garlicky finish. The addition of Andouille sausage gives the dish a distinctly Louisiana-inspired depth.

Because boils are built around whole shellfish and multiple components served together, they tend to be one of the more filling, hands-on entrées on the entire menu, and they’re frequently recommended for guests who want the full “seafood shack” experience rather than a plated fillet.

Mama Blue’s Shrimp Gumbo, combining fish, Andouille sausage, poached shrimp, okra, and steamed rice, offers a similar Southern flavor profile in a soup format rather than a full boil, giving guests a lighter alternative within the same flavor family.

Sampler Platters

Sampler platters give guests a way to try several menu items in one order, and the Run Across America Sampler is the standout option, bundling fried shrimp, seafood hush pups, chicken tenders, queso dip, tortilla chips, chili ancho aioli, and ranch dressing onto one large shareable plate. Priced at $26.99, it’s built for a table rather than a single guest.

Because this sampler combines fried seafood with a non-seafood option like chicken tenders, it works well for mixed groups where not everyone wants a full seafood entrée. The variety of dipping sauces included also gives guests a chance to sample several of the restaurant’s signature sauce flavors in one order.

Salads & Handhelds

Salads and handhelds round out the lighter side of the Bubba Gump menu, and the Strawberry Fields Salad, combining mixed greens, grilled shrimp, strawberries, apples, raspberry vinaigrette, feta cheese, and glazed pecans, is one of the more popular lighter options for guests who want protein without a fried or pasta-heavy dish.

The Shrimp Po’ Boy, built with shrimp, lettuce, tomato, pickle, and mayo served with fries, gives a handheld alternative to the plated seafood entrées. For vegetarian guests, a Beyond Patty burger, topped with spring mix, tomato, red onion, and avocado, offers a fully plant-based option alongside the seafood-heavy core of the menu.

From The Farm & Combination Plates

From The Farm items give non-seafood guests options within the same menu, including a Sautéed Chicken Breast with cream sauce, spinach, grape tomatoes, parmesan cheese, and linguine. This dish can also be upgraded with a grilled shrimp skewer for an additional $5.99, letting guests blend land and sea in one order.

Combination plates pair two proteins on one dish, such as Baby Back Ribs with Grilled Shrimp and Fries, or a Boneless Ribeye with Grilled Shrimp, Mashed Potatoes, and Onion Rings. These combination options are generally priced toward the higher end of the individual entrée range, reflecting the inclusion of two separate proteins on one plate.

Kids’ Menu & Desserts

The Kids’ Menu offers a wide range of familiar options, including Chicken Strips, Mini Corn Dogs, Cheeseburger, Popcorn Shrimp, BBQ Ribs, Fish Sticks, Mac & Cheese, Elbow Pasta with marinara, and Kid’s Pizza in cheese or pepperoni. Each kids’ meal comes with a choice of side, including apple sauce, french fries, fresh fruit, carrots and celery sticks, or a garden salad.

For dessert, an Oreo Cookie Sundae, combining vanilla ice cream, chocolate syrup, Snickers pieces, Oreo crumbs, sprinkles, whipped cream, and a maraschino cherry, is priced at $3.99. On the adult dessert menu, a New York Style Cheesecake topped with fresh strawberry sauce rounds out the options for guests who want something more classic.
